A Brief Overview of Dubai International Financial Centre

Established in 2004, the DIFC is designed to promote financial services, providing a robust environment for businesses to thrive. The architecture itself reflects modernity and ambition, with skyscrapers that stand as a testament to Dubai’s rapid growth. Significant landmarks such as the Gate Building and the DIFC Courts affirm the area’s commitment to an international business framework.

The Role of DIFC in Dubai's Economy

DIFC plays a critical role in the broader economic ecosystem of Dubai, serving as a cornerstone for financial and professional services. Home to over 26,000 professionals employed across more than 2,500 companies, it significantly contributes to job creation while driving economic growth.

  • Attraction of International Investment: DIFC acts as a magnet for foreign investment, which bolsters local businesses and fosters innovation. International firms, ranging from financial institutions to legal consultancies, find the infrastructure and regulatory framework conducive for operation.
  • Convergence of Culture and Commerce: DIFC is not merely about finance; it also encourages cultural interactions through art galleries and theaters, showing that the district is as much about lifestyle as it is about business.

Asian Cuisine

Asian cuisine in DIFC is a vibrant tapestry, weaving traditional recipes with modern twists. Restaurants like Hakkasan and Zuma take center stage, representing the finest in high-end Asian dining in Dubai. Diners can expect an array of flavors—from the peppery heat of Szechuan to the creamy richness of Malaysian curries.

  • Signature Dishes: At Zuma, the miso-marinated black cod is a standout, with its rich umami flavor that dances on the palate. Hakkasan offers a delectable crispy duck salad that redefines the concept of a starter.

Beyond the glitz, there are also lesser-known spots that serve authentic Asian fare. Discovering these restaurants can lead to delightful culinary surprises, where you might stumble upon a hidden gem serving homemade dumplings or perfectly grilled satay.

Making Reservations

When it comes to making reservations at DIFC restaurants, it’s best not to leave things to chance. Many establishments allow for online bookings through their websites or third-party platforms like OpenTable. Here are some points to consider:

  • Check Availability Early: Some popular places can book up quickly, particularly on weekends or during special events. To avoid disappointment, consider reserving a table well in advance.
  • Be Flexible: If your heart is set on a specific restaurant, having a range of times for your booking can increase your chances of getting in. Lunchtime slots, for instance, might be less busy than dinner.
  • Confirm Your Reservation: A follow-up call a day or two before your dining experience can clear up any potential mix-ups. In high-demand places, it’s possible for reservations to slip through the cracks.

Best Times to Dine

Timing can greatly affect your dining experience in DIFC. Here are some insights on the best times to enjoy your meal:

  • Weekdays vs Weekends: Weekdays, especially for lunch, can offer a quieter atmosphere, perfect for a business lunch or casual dining without the crowd.
  • Lunch Hours: If you’re looking to dine relatively peacefully, aim for an early lunch or a late afternoon slot. Many restaurants tend to quiet down post-1:30 PM, making it an ideal time for a relaxed meal.
  • Dinner Reservations: For dinner, especially at high-end venues, a reservation between 7 PM and 8 PM is recommended. However, be prepared for a bustling environment during these times as more diners flock to enjoy the vibrant nightlife.
